Product Description
The Transition Networks SGFEB1040-230 is identified as a transceiver and media converter, indicating its role in facilitating communication between different network media types. In modern networking, this typically involves converting signals between copper Ethernet (like twisted-pair cabling) and fiber optic cabling, or between different types of fiber optic connections (e.g., multimode to single-mode, or different wavelengths). As a transceiver, it likely incorporates both a transmitter and a receiver to send and receive optical signals. The 'media converter' aspect reinforces its function of translating data signals from one physical medium to another. This is essential for extending network distances, improving signal integrity, or connecting devices that use incompatible network interfaces. The specific capabilities, such as supported speeds (e.g., 10/100 Mbps, Gigabit Ethernet), fiber types (multimode, single-mode), wavelengths, and connector types (SC, LC, RJ45), would depend on the detailed specifications of this particular model. However, its classification suggests it's a component used within network infrastructure to ensure interoperability and extend network reach.
